Output d4777ef1a9162e2feaee567ab07880ba61c11dcf5892513a35432003389f3fd5:22

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db008fe399fa6e828c5c878291a83377a105fd4e OP_EQUAL
address
3MezacCXp94AHnn9r9pT6sybVmsxHuSZp6
transaction
d4777ef1a9162e2feaee567ab07880ba61c11dcf5892513a35432003389f3fd5
spent
true